crystal structure of human phosphoribosyl pyrophosphate synthetase 1 mutant S132A

Template:ABSTRACT PUBMED 16939420

Disease

Known disease associated with this structure: Arts syndrome OMIM:[311850], Charcot-Marie-Tooth disease, X-linked recessive, 5 OMIM:[311850], Gout, PRPS-related OMIM:[311850], Phosphoribosylpyrophosphate synthetase superactivity OMIM:[311850]

About this Structure

2H07 is a 2 chains structure of sequences from Homo sapiens. Full crystallographic information is available from OCA.

Reference

  • Li S, Lu Y, Peng B, Ding J. Crystal structure of human phosphoribosylpyrophosphate synthetase 1 reveals a novel allosteric site. Biochem J. 2007 Jan 1;401(1):39-47. PMID:16939420 doi:10.1042/BJ20061066
